Why Concrete and Foundation Sales in Clearwater Is a High-Earning Opportunity
Florida's sandy soil, heavy rainfall, and high humidity create relentless pressure on residential foundations and concrete surfaces. Clearwater homeowners deal with slab settlement, driveway erosion, basement wall cracking, and mudjacking needs year-round. That consistent demand translates directly into opportunity for reps who know how to run an in-home sales appointment and close on the first visit.
Average job tickets in foundation repair range from $8,000 to $30,000, and concrete replacement or resurfacing projects frequently land between $3,500 and $12,000. A rep running five to eight demos per week with a solid one-call close rate can realistically earn six figures in their first full year. Top performers at established companies in this vertical consistently clear $200k+ sales jobs territory, especially when they own a protected geographic book and stack bonuses on top of base commission.
Unlike industries where deals drag through procurement cycles, high-ticket sales in home improvement are decided at the kitchen table. That speed rewards closers who are skilled at objection handling, financing conversations, and building trust with homeowners under pressure.
What Contractors in Clearwater Should Look for When Hiring
Hiring the wrong rep costs more than leaving a territory open. The best concrete and foundation sales reps share a specific profile, and it is not a college diploma. No degree required is a genuine feature of this trade, not a consolation. What matters is track record, coachability, and the ability to sit across from a homeowner and earn a signed contract without a second visit.
Core Traits to Screen For
- Proven one-call close ability, ideally in adjacent verticals like roofing, solar, HVAC, windows, or remodeling where the same high-pressure, in-home sales dynamic applies.
- Comfort with high-ticket sales conversations involving financing, warranty discussions, and scope-of-work walkthroughs.
- Self-managed pipeline discipline, including CRM hygiene, follow-up on unsold demos, and accurate forecasting against quota.
- Strong objection handling, particularly around price sensitivity, spouse decisions, and competing bids.
- Local market familiarity, knowing neighborhoods like Safety Harbor, Dunedin, and Largo helps reps relate to homeowners and reduces rapport-building time on every appointment.

Sales Jobs in Clearwater That Attract Top Closers
The best reps in Clearwater have options. Roofing companies, solar installers, and window replacement firms compete aggressively for the same talent pool. To win those closers for your concrete or foundation company, your compensation package needs to be transparent and compelling. Advertise your realistic OTE, not just base salary. If your top rep earned $180,000 last year on commission, say that clearly. Reps who are serious about six figures and $200k+ sales jobs will respond to honesty over corporate language.
